21V121000 · Engine; Engine And Engine Cooling:engine:engine Control Module (ecu/ecm):software

Feb 25, 2021

Daimler Trucks North America, LLC (DTNA) is recalling certain 2019-2020 Freightliner Custom Chass XBA Chassis equipped with Cummins B6.7N engines. The engine control module software may be calibrated incorrectly, causing the engine to not limit engine speed or torque as intended for certain safety-related functions such as vehicle braking, traction and stability control, speed control, or collision avoidance.

Consequence & remedy

Consequence: If safety-related functions such as vehicle braking, stability, speed, and collision avoidance do not function properly, it can increase the risk of a crash.

Remedy: DTNA will work with the engine manufacturer Cummins Inc. to notify owners, and Cummins dealers will recalibrate the engine control module, free of charge. Owner notification letters were mailed on March 29, 2021. Owners may contact DTNA customer service at 1-800-547-0712. DTNA number for this recall is FL-879.
